To maximize the benefits of utilizing a gym bicycle, adhering to finest practices is important. The following list describes essential suggestions for reliable and safe workouts:

  1. Adjust the Seat Height: Proper seat height is crucial for convenience and performance. Set the seat so that your knees are a little bent at the bottom of the pedal stroke.

  2. Keep Correct Posture: Keep the back straight, shoulders unwinded, and arms somewhat bent. This avoids stress and fatigue during exercises.

  3. Heat up and Cool Down: Begin with a 5-10 minute warm-up at a low resistance to prepare the muscles. Likewise, cool off at a lower intensity to help the body recuperate.

  4. Vary Intensity: Incorporate various resistances and speeds to preserve engagement and difficulty muscles. High-intensity periods can enhance calorie burn and cardiovascular fitness.

  5. Screen Heart Rate: Use heart rate screens or fitness trackers to make sure exercises are within the target heart rate zone, optimizing cardiovascular advantages.

  6. Stay Hydrated: Drink water before, during, and after exercises to maintain hydration levels and boost efficiency.

  7. Integrate Different Workouts: Mix in different exercises, such as steady-state cycling, interval training, or endurance rides, to target different fitness goals.

  8. Listen to Your Body: Pay attention to any discomfort or pain. If something feels off, it's important to stop and examine the cause.

FAQ

1. How typically should I utilize a gym bicycle?

It is normally advised to engage in cardiovascular exercises, consisting of fitness center bicycles, at least 150 minutes per week at moderate intensity or 75 minutes at high strength. This can be broken down into several sessions throughout the week.

2. What resistance level should I begin with?

Newbies should begin at a low resistance level to avoid stress and slowly increase it as their fitness level improves. A typical technique is to maintain a cadence of around 60-80 RPM (transformations per minute) at moderate resistance.

3. Are gym bikes appropriate for all physical fitness levels?

Yes, gym bicycles are flexible and can be adjusted to accommodate all physical fitness levels. Recumbent bikes, for example, offer included support for newbies or those with physical constraints.

4. Can gym bicycles help with weight-loss?

Yes, fitness center bikes can aid with weight loss when combined with a balanced diet plan and regular exercise. They work for burning calories and improving metabolic health.

5. Should I use a gym bicycle if I have joint problems?

Recumbent bikes are frequently suggested for individuals with joint concerns, as they supply back support and minimize pressure on the joints. Nevertheless, it's recommended to talk to a health care professional before starting any new exercise regimen.
